Died 7:30 p.m. Wednesday, Feb. 16, 1994, at her residence in Prairieville. She was 76 and a native of Sunset. Visiting at Ourso Funeral Home, Gonzales, 3 to 9 p.m. Friday. Visiting at the funeral home chapel, 8 to 9:30 a.m. Saturday. Mass of Christian Burial at St. John the Evangelist Catholic Church, Prairieville, at 10 a.m. Saturday, conducted by the Rev. Kenneth Laird. Burial in Prairieville Community Cemetery. Survived by husband, Smiley J. Babin, Prairieville; three daughters and sons-in-law, Alice B. and Ben Weaver, Mary B. and David Guedry, both of Donaldsonville, and Nettie B. and Bernard LeBlanc, Baton Rouge; a son and daughter-in-law, James and Verna Miziner Burleigh, Prairieville; six grandchildren; 10 great-grandchildren;and a great-great-grandchild. Preceded in death by parents, Adelbuart and Lillian Richard Wills; a daughter, Lillian Pearl Margaret Burleigh; a grandson, Randy LeBlanc; and three brothers, Easton, Weston and Jules Wills. Pallbearers will be Glenn and Bernard LeBlanc, Scott Burleigh, David Guedry, Ben Weaver and C.J. Arceneaux.

The Advocate (Baton Rouge, La.) - Friday, February 18, 1994
